    Abstract: The present invention relates to a method to control a hybrid powertrain, comprising a combustion engine, an electric machine, a gearbox with input shaft and output shaft, wherein the combustion engine and the electric machine are connected to the input shaft. The method comprises the following steps: a) disconnecting the combustion engine from the input shaft with a coupling device, b) engaging a starting gear in the gearbox, which starting gear is higher than the gear at which the combustion engine's torque at idling speed is able to operate the input shaft, c) generating a torque in the input shaft with the electric machine, d) accelerating the electric machine, and e) connecting the combustion engine to the input shaft with the coupling device when the electric machine has reached substantially the same rotational speed as the combustion engine. The invention also relates to a hybrid powertrain and a vehicle.

    Abstract: The present invention relates to a method for determining the specific gas constant and the stoichiometric air fuel ratio of a fuel gas for a gas engine. The method comprises keeping the pressure essentially constant in an inlet manifold of the gas engine, so that the pressure is not varying more than a pre-determined threshold. A first ? value is determined downstream the gas engine. The time period of gas injection into the inlet manifold is then changed. A second ? value downstream the gas engine is determined. The specific gas constant and the stoichiometric air fuel ratio of the fuel gas is then determined based on the determined first and second ? value. The present invention also relates to a system for determining the specific gas constant and the stoichiometric air fuel ratio of a fuel gas for a gas engine, a vehicle, and a computer program product.

    Abstract: An engine system is provided that uses lubrication oil that forms water-soluble ash when combusted. The engine system comprises an internal combustion engine lubricated by the lubrication oil; an exhaust gas system for cleaning exhaust gases from the internal combustion engine, the exhaust gas system comprising a diesel particulate filter to capture particulate matter from the exhaust gases, wherein the particulate matter comprises the water-soluble ash; an exhaust gas conduit to lead exhaust gases from the internal combustion engine to the exhaust gas system; and condensation means to accumulate condensed water and/or to form an increased amount of condensed water and arranged in fluid connection with the exhaust gas flow upstream of the diesel particulate filter. The exhaust gas conduit is arranged to collect condensed water and lead the condensed water through the diesel particulate filter, thereby dissolving and thus removing the water-soluble ash from the diesel particulate filter.
